Hey Marisol — handing over before I head out. The hardware lab on Level 2 is all yours tonight. The Vexler rigs are mid-burn-in, so please don't power-cycle bench 4 no matter how much the fans whine. Oscilloscope cart went back to the cage, key's in the usual drawer. If the soldering station smells weird again, just unplug it and log it for Priya. The side door reader was reset this afternoon, so you'll need the new pass code below.

turnstile pass: bdg-NNMWFJ-69474011

// REBUILD_BATCH_LIMIT: caps pages re-rendered per incremental pass.
// Raised from 40 to 120 after the Thornvale docs migration; full
// rebuilds were starving the queue. Dependency graph now prunes
// unchanged includes, so larger batches are safe. Revisit if p95
// rebuild latency exceeds 90s. Discussed at weekly sync; the
// benchmark was run against the build noted below.

build token for fahap-yagag: htk3_d09

# Lanternfold Suggest — Environments

Three environments: dev, staging, prod. The autocomplete index is known-slow in staging because it shares disks with analytics; do not benchmark there. Prod rebuilds run nightly. If suggest latency spikes, check rebuild lag first. The staging environment currently runs with the following configuration values.

service settings:
[casax]
port = 6379
team = rusir
host = casax.zemvarhq.corp
region = outer-4
access_code = ac_9808ce
timeout_ms = 1500

## Sensor drift: what to do at 3am

If the GrowLoop controller starts reporting humidity swings that don't match the backup probes in the Fernwick greenhouse, it's almost always sensor drift, not an actual climate event. Don't panic and don't touch the vents manually. First, restart the calibration daemon and give it ten minutes to re-baseline. If readings still disagree by more than 5%, flip the controller into safe mode. The safe-mode thresholds it will use are these.

config for yahap-bajof:
[istix]
host = istix.qorvelsys.internal
user = istix_svc
database = istix_prod